Mont Vallon K1 Map

Just at the top of the red runs where they split, there's a signpost. Below the sign post is the mighty K1 face. Wide open couloir narrowing slightly with rock outcrops as you get to the last quarter. Often fills in with snow so watch out for windslab on entrance and possible bombing damage by pisteurs. It brings you right back onto the red slope of Combe De Vallon.
